In my experience, on MacOSX >= 10.6, you don't need to install xquartz unless you have special needs for the very latest version. In fact, the "stock" X11 *is* xquartz, just not quite the latest. MacOSX was a special case; for some reason or other, Apple was unable to ship a decent version of X11 with the OS. Despite several updates, they never got their act together.
